Ken'ichi Ohmichi e73cb83f9e Use wsgi.response for v2.1 API
Now a decorator @wsgi.response() can be used for specifying success
status code. Most v2.1 APIs use the decorator and it makes the code
more readable. This patch replaces webob.Response with the decorator
for the other APIs.
In addition, this patch changes some orders of decorators for showing
success code and expected error codes clearly.

Even if applying this patch, some webob.Response() calls still exist
under the path nova/api/openstack/compute/plugins/v3/ because these
cases need to contain some information in a response header.

Partially implements blueprint v2-on-v3-api
